Dear Students and Parents,
My name is Vinny, and I am excited to help you or your child find confidence and success in mathematics. My passion for teaching began at UC San Diego, where I served as a resident math tutor for the dormitories, providing dedicated academic support to students navigating challenging coursework. Since then, I have tutored over twenty students on an ad-hoc basis across various grade levels. I also bring a unique perspective from a twenty-year professional career at Kaiser Permanente. This extensive background in the professional world has gifted me with the maturity, reliability, and extreme patience necessary to help students move past "math anxiety" and tackle problems with a calm, step-by-step approach.
I currently specialize in elementary and middle school math, specifically focusing on the critical window of grades 2 through 6. I understand that the way math is taught in schools has changed significantly, which is why I have recently completed intensive retraining through Khan Academy to master the modern "Common Core" visual models and methods used in today’s classrooms. My tutoring approach is centered on "speaking the same language" as your child's teacher, ensuring that our sessions reinforce school curriculum rather than causing confusion. Whether we are working on multi-digit multiplication or the complexities of fractions, my goal is to create a supportive environment where students feel comfortable asking questions and viewing mistakes as a natural part of the learning process.
